CONTRIBUTION LIMITS For the 2025 calendar year, the IRS allows you to contribute up to following amounts into your Health Savings Account: • Single coverage: $4,300 • Any tier of Family coverage: $8,550 • Additional catch-up contribution: Age 55+: $1,000 IRS limits include combined employer and employee contributions H E A L T H S A V I N G S A C C O U N T HSA Introduction Only for those enrolling in the High Deductible Health Plan (HDHP), you are eligible set up a Health Saving Account (HSA). Health Savings Accounts allow you to set aside pre-tax money to help cover your deductible and pay for other out-of-pocket healthcare expenses for you and your dependents. Pre-tax payroll deductions Tax-free withdrawals for eligible expenses Tax-free growth from interest or investment returns ü You can start, stop, or change your contribution amount during the year. ü You can use funds for yourself, your spouse, and/or eligible tax dependents — whether they are on your medical plan or not. ü You cannot contribute to an HSA once you’ve enrolled in Medicare, but you can use any existing HSA dollars on health expenses, including Medicare premiums. Visit your healthcare provider and the office will submit the claim to your health plan. As the administrator of our health plan, Cigna processes your claim(s) and will share the amount you owe with your doctor. Providers in the Cigna network will cost you less than non contracted providers. Cigna sends you the Explanation of Benefits (EOB), which includes the amount you owe the doctor. Your doctor will then send you a bill, which should match the amount due on the Explanation of Benefits. You can use your HSA funds to pay the bill from your doctor. If you pay out of pocket, you can reimburse yourself from your HSA. FAMILY DEDUCTIBLES AND OUT-OF-POCKET MAXIMUMS ARE EMBEDDED The deductible and out-of-pocket maximum for each person in the family is capped at the individual amount. In other words, once an individual has reached the individual deductible amount, the plan will start paying benefits for that person. And, once the combined expenses of all family members reaches the family amount, the deductible or out-of- pocket maximum will be considered met for all family members (even if they haven’t met the individual amount). C O S T O F C O V E R A G E Annual Employee Spend Copays Deductibles Coinsurance Out of Pocket Expenses Premium Pre-tax Payroll Deductions HOW YOU PAY FOR HEALTH CARE COSTS Remember, your total health care cost for the year is the combination of your out-of- pocket expenses when you access medical care and the premium contributions you make for coverage. Depending on your personal situation, the plan with the lowest deductibles and copays may not be the best plan for you. Be sure to look at the total cost of your expected care before making your plan decisions for the plan year. TOTAL COST OF CARE

F L E X I B L E S P E N D I N G A C C O U N T S Flexible Spending Accounts (FSAs) are set up to pay for many of out-of-pocket medical expenses with tax-free dollars. The FSA account holder sets aside a pre-tax dollar amount for the year used to pay for medical expenses. Unused FSA funds can expire at the end of the year, so it is important to calculate expected expenses as accurately as possible prior to adding funds. 1 HEALTHCARE FSA The FSA can be paired with a Copay Plan. Employees who enroll in the HDHP are NOT eligible for the Healthcare FSA. FSA funds can be used on various medical, dental, and vision related expenses – the benefit is to use tax-free dollars on these purchases. The IRS has set the contribution maximum to $3,300 annually. 2 LIMITED PURPOSE FSA The Limited Purpose FSA can be paired with BOTH the HDHP or the Copay Plan. The Limited Purpose FSA can be used on Dental and Vision expenses only. By adding money to a Limited Purpose FSA, employees can use tax-free dollars on dental and vision expenses. The IRS has set the contribution maximum to $3,300 annually. WATCH THIS FSA VIDEO TO LEARN MORE VIEW ELIGIBLE EXPENSES 3 DEPENDENT CARE ACCOUNT (DCA) FSA A DCA can also be paired with BOTH the HDHP or the Copay Plan. A DCA is a tax-free account for dependent care expenses such as daycare, preschool, or day camps for any dependent under the age of 13 or who are physically or mentally incapable of self-care. The IRS has set the contribution maximum at $5,000 for families and $2,500 for individuals. LEARN MORE ABOUT YOUR DCA Important Enrollment Information You must enroll each year to participate. A D D I T I O N A L B E N E F I T S G R O U P L I F E A N D A D & D E M P L O Y E R P A I D L O N G - T E R M D I S A B I L I T Y E M P L O Y E R P A I D S H O R T - T E R M D I S A B I L I T Y The group life and accidental death and dismemberment policy is available to all full-time employees in the amount of $50,000. In the event of death, loss of (or loss of use of) a body part or function, speech, eyesight, or hearing, your beneficiaries will receive benefits. Short-term disability protects your income during a short period of time due to illness or an accident not related to your job. Benefits begin on the 8th day after an illness or accident. The policy will pay 60% of your weekly income up to $1,500 for 13 weeks. Long-term disability protects your income for an extended period of time. Benefits begin on the 91st day after the date of the incident and will cover 60% of your earnings, up to $6,000/month.
